The Mortgage Corner with GreenState Credit Union – March 2026
A Win for Homebuyers: How the New Credit Inquiry “Trigger Lead” Law Helps Mortgage
Borrowers

 

Buying a home is one of the most exciting financial steps a person can take—but until recently, starting
the mortgage process often came with an unexpected downside. The moment a lender pulled a
borrower’s credit for a mortgage application, that inquiry could trigger the credit bureaus to sell the
consumers’ information to other lenders, leading to a flood of unsolicited calls, texts, and emails.
Now, a new federal law is changing that experience for the better.


What the New Law Does
The Homebuyers Privacy Protection Act, which took effect in March 2026, significantly restricts the
sale of mortgage “trigger leads.” In the past, credit bureaus could sell data indicating that someone had
applied for a mortgage, allowing competing lenders to immediately contact that borrower.
Under the new rules, credit reporting agencies are largely prohibited from selling that inquiry information
to unrelated lenders. Only companies with an existing relationship with the borrower—or those with
explicit consumer permission — can reach out.


Why This Is Good for Homebuyers
This change creates several important benefits for consumers entering the mortgage process:
1. Less confusion during a critical decision
Previously, borrowers could receive dozens of calls from lenders within hours of a credit check. Many
believed their lender or real estate agent had shared their information, creating unnecessary confusion.
2. Greater privacy and control
Homebuyers now have more control over who has access to their financial information, helping protect
them from aggressive marketing or misleading offers.
3. A smoother mortgage experience
Without the distraction of constant unsolicited outreach, borrowers can focus on working with the trusted
lender they chose and confidently move through the home financing process.


What It Means for Future Homeowners
For those pursuing homeownership, this law represents a meaningful improvement in the mortgage
journey. The homebuying process can already feel complex and overwhelming. By limiting intrusive
marketing and protecting consumer data, the new trigger lead protections help create a more transparent,
trustworthy environment for borrowers.


Ultimately, the goal is simple: when you apply for a mortgage, your focus should be on finding the right
home and the right loan—not managing a barrage of unexpected calls.
